Learn more about Bing search results hereOrganizing and summarizing search results for youThe scientific method has six basic steps, or five basic steps plus one feedback step. These steps are:- Make observations
- Ask a question
- Form a hypothesis
- Test the hypothesis
- Analyze the data and draw conclusions
- Communicate the results to others
